Output 83bb0ae16e13c76044d31876917d4740651d0188e5f88907a65a178d819c2efa:2

value
1048576
script pubkey
OP_0 OP_PUSHBYTES_20 2893ade4e178f9aac64078f017310f473025561a
address
bc1q9zf6me8p0ru643jq0rcpwvg0gucz24s6x4p352
transaction
83bb0ae16e13c76044d31876917d4740651d0188e5f88907a65a178d819c2efa
spent
true